WebPayment for order flow (PFOF) is the practice of wholesale market makers paying brokers (typically retail brokers) for their clients’ order flow. By acquiring order flow in this way, market makers are able to trade profitably against client orders (on average) while clients may benefit from reduced trading costs because WebOrder flow is another term used in place of transaction flow.
